Bamise: Passengers Stranded As BRT Suspends Operations

Following the death of 22-year-old Bamise Ayanwole, who was allegedly abducted and killed after boarding a BRT vehicle on Friday, Passengers has been left stranded at the various Bus Rapid Transit (BRT) terminals across the state.

There are speculations that the BRT has suspended operations for fear of been attacked.

According to report, no bus was in sight at the Ikorodu BRT terminal to convey stranded passengers to their various destinations.

An official of Primero, confirmed to newsmen that the BRT has suspended its operations temporarily across the state.

He however, assured commuters that the issue is being handled by the state government and services would be restored as soon as possible.
